How Do You Prepare a Tub for Planting?

Getting your tub ready for planting is super important. You need to make sure it has good drainage. This means water can flow out easily. If not, the roots of your plants might rot. Start by drilling some holes in the bottom of the tub. Then, add a layer of gravel or small stones. This helps the water drain even better. Next, fill the tub with good quality potting soil. Don’t use soil from your yard, because it might be too heavy. Make sure the soil is loose and airy. This will help the roots grow strong. Now you are ready to plant your flowers, vegetables, or herbs. Remember to water them regularly and give them plenty of sunlight. How Deep Should the Tub Be?

The depth of your large galvanized tubs for gardening is important. Different plants need different depths for their roots. Shallow-rooted plants like lettuce and herbs don’t need a very deep tub. But deep-rooted plants like tomatoes and carrots need more room. A good rule of thumb is to choose a tub that is at least 12 inches deep. This will give most plants enough space to grow. If you are planting something like a tomato, you might want to go even deeper. The deeper the tub, the more room the roots have to spread out. This means the plant will be stronger and healthier. So when you are choosing your tub, think about the roots!

How to Grow Tomatoes in Galvanized Tubs

Growing tomatoes in large galvanized tubs for gardening is easy and rewarding. Choose a large tub, at least 24 inches wide and deep. Fill it with good quality potting soil. Add some compost for extra nutrients. Plant one tomato plant per tub. Use a tomato cage or stake to support the plant as it grows. Tomatoes need lots of sunlight, so place the tub in a sunny spot. Water regularly, especially during hot weather. Fertilize every few weeks with a tomato fertilizer. You will be enjoying fresh, homegrown tomatoes in no time!

How to Protect Your Tub Garden in Winter

Protecting your large galvanized tubs for gardening in winter is important. If you live in a cold climate, the soil in the tubs can freeze. This can damage the roots of the plants. Move the tubs to a sheltered location, such as a garage or shed. If you can’t move the tubs, wrap them in burlap or blankets. This will help insulate the soil. Water the plants sparingly during the winter. Don’t fertilize them, as they are not actively growing. With a little protection, your tub garden will survive the winter and be ready to grow again in the spring.

Question No 1: Are galvanized tubs safe for growing vegetables?

Answer: Yes, galvanized tubs are generally safe for growing vegetables. Galvanization is a process that coats the metal with zinc to prevent rust. While some zinc can leach into the soil, the amount is usually minimal and not harmful to plants or humans. To be extra cautious, you can line the tub with plastic or use a food-grade sealant. Also, avoid using very old tubs that may have been treated with harmful chemicals. Question No 2: How do I drill drainage holes in a galvanized tub?

Answer: Drilling drainage holes in a galvanized tub is easy. You will need a drill, a metal drill bit, and safety glasses. Choose a drill bit that is about ¼ inch in diameter. Mark the spots where you want to drill the holes. A good rule of thumb is to drill several holes evenly spaced across the bottom of the tub. Put on your safety glasses and carefully drill through the metal. Apply steady pressure and let the drill do the work. Don’t force it, or you could damage the tub. Once you have drilled the holes, you are ready to add gravel and soil. Proper drainage is essential for healthy plants in large galvanized tubs for gardening.

Question No 4: How do I prevent my galvanized tub from rusting?

Answer: Galvanized tubs are designed to resist rust. But over time, the zinc coating can wear away. To prevent rust, avoid scratching or damaging the surface of the tub. Clean the tub regularly with soap and water. If you notice any rust spots, you can treat them with a rust converter. This will stop the rust from spreading. You can also apply a sealant to the inside of the tub. This will protect the metal from moisture. With proper care, your large galvanized tubs for gardening can last for many years without rusting.
